VIDEO: Grizzlies' Matt Barnes beats Pistons with half-court heave

Justin Ford / USA TODAY Sports

Off to a wobbly start to the season, playing on the second night of a back-to-back, coming off the worst home loss in franchise history, and with their best player hobbled, the Memphis Grizzlies needed something to go right against the Detroit Pistons.

In the end, they needed something more than that. Trailing the Pistons by two points near the end of regulation (after playing from behind for the entire second half), with the clock dwindling fast and no timeouts left, the Grizzlies needed a miracle.

Enter Matt Barnes, who snatched up a Marcus Morris miss with just five seconds to play, raced upcourt, and sent up a prayer from just behind the time line.

Somewhere, someone heard it.

Heck of a way to win a ball game.
